DA14 GJY is a 2014 Audi A5 in Black with a 1,968c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 15 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 66.7%.

Across all 2014 Audi A5 models, the average MOT pass rate is 84.0% with a typical mileage of 66,012 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Audi A5 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 17,175 recorded failures. If you're considering buying DA14 GJY,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Audi A5 typically stays on UK roads for around 19 years. At 12 years old, this Audi A5 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
